About Us: Closer to Home Community Services (CTH) is a Calgary and Airdrie based not-for-profit agency that delivers a variety of services designed to meet the needs of vulnerable children and their families. Be a part of an innovative team that envisions:A future where every child will belong to a family and feel valued and secureAll families can care for their children and contribute meaningfully in their communityA broad array of strength-based and family-centered services that teach, coach and support families to create new possibilities and achieve better futures togetherAbout the Position: In this Part-Time (0.80 FTE) position, the Payroll Assistant will support the Payroll Administrator to create and maintain employee records in the Payroll system, verify timesheets and follow up anomalies, process bi-weekly payroll and process ROE’s. The Payroll Assistant will also train new staff to successfully use the Payroll system, respond to staff queries, perform monthly reconciliations, and prepare ad hoc reports requested by management and third parties.About You: You are a self-motivated individual with the ability to maintain a high degree of professionalism and confidentiality. You are extremely detail oriented, able to work independently and are highly organized, allowing you to effectively manage multiple priorities at one time. You are also extremely adaptable and can adjust to changing priorities as needed. In addition, you have exceptional written and verbal communication skills and are comfortable interacting with people from a variety of backgrounds as well as with people at all levels of the organization. You are culturally competent and able to conduct yourself in a manner which is respectful and encouraging of the cultural/spiritual beliefs and practices of others.A Diploma in a related field and minimum of three years of previous of payroll service experience is required. Experience processing payroll using Dayforce or an equivalent software is an asset, as well as proficiency in Word, Excel, Power Point, Google Workspaces Suite (Gmail) and Adobe.
